Why Austin Is the New Tech Powerhouse

In recent years, Austin, Texas has become one of the fastest-growing tech hubs in the U.S. With companies like Tesla, Apple, Google, Meta, Oracle, and Amazon expanding operations here, the demand for nearby housing has surged. According to the Austin Business Journal, over 270 tech companies now operate in the region, creating jobs that draw top talent from across the country.

Top Austin Tech Hubs and Nearby Neighborhoods

1. North Austin / The Domain Tech Corridor

Tech Companies Nearby: Amazon, IBM, Indeed, Facebook/Meta, HomeAway (Expedia), VRBO

Top Neighborhoods:

  • Wells Branch: Accessible pricing, established community feel, quick access to The Domain

  • North Burnet: Urban environment with new condos close to tech employers

  • Milwood: Offers a mix of housing styles and access to area parks and trails

  • Round Rock & Pflugerville: New developments with strong commuter access and value

Median Home Price (2025 est.): $485,000 – $700,000+
Commute Time: 10–25 minutes


2. Northwest Austin / Apple Tech Corridor

Tech Companies Nearby: Apple, eBay, PayPal, Amazon, NI

Top Neighborhoods:

  • Canyon Creek: Known for its extensive trail systems and natural surroundings

  • Jollyville: Offers established housing options and steady price growth

  • Brushy Creek: Offers spacious layouts and convenient access to local amenities

  • Cedar Park & Leander: Expanding suburban areas with new housing options and strong infrastructure

  • Liberty Hill: Offers larger parcels and growing development potential

Median Home Price (2025 est.): $525,000 – $765,000+
Commute Time: 15–30 minutes


3. Downtown Austin & Seaholm District

Tech Companies Nearby: Google, Atlassian, Canva, Apple (downtown office)

Top Neighborhoods:

  • Clarksville: Historic architecture and walkable streets

  • East Cesar Chavez: Energetic community with modern housing options

  • Rainey Street District: Walkable condo living near entertainment and offices

  • Zilker, Bouldin Creek, Barton Hills: Iconic central Austin areas with green space and direct access to downtown

Median Home Price: $730,000 – $1.25M+ (condos on the lower end)
Commute Time: Walkable to 10 minutes


4. East Austin / Tesla Gigafactory & Airport Area

Tech Companies Nearby: Tesla, SpaceX, Boring Company

Top Neighborhoods:

  • Del Valle: Active growth corridor with newer housing

  • McKinney Falls / Easton Park: Master-planned communities with parks and amenities

  • Elroy: Offers more space with future development upside

  • Mueller: A sustainable, mixed-use neighborhood with shops, parks, and transit access

Median Home Price: $395,000 – $825,000+
Commute Time: 5–15 minutes to Tesla


5. South Austin / Oracle Waterfront Campus

Tech Companies Nearby: Oracle, NXP Semiconductors

Top Neighborhoods:

  • Travis Heights: Tree-lined streets and close proximity to South Congress shopping and dining

  • St. Elmo: New development area with modern design and creative spaces

  • East Riverside: High-density area with improving infrastructure

  • South Austin Core: An eclectic mix of vintage and modern homes with access to music, dining, and community venues

Median Home Price: $460,000 – $875,000+
Commute Time: 5–20 minutes


6. West Austin / Outlying Communities

Why Buyers Choose This Area: Known for its scenic surroundings, larger properties, and appeal to those with flexible commute needs.

Top Neighborhoods & Suburbs:

  • Bee Cave: Hilltop views, retail hubs, and golf courses

  • Dripping Springs: Active new construction and access to Hill Country attractions, trails, and open space

  • Georgetown: Historic downtown, master-planned communities, and a balance of charm and modern living

Median Home Price: $500,000 – $800,000+
Commute Time: 30–45+ minutes


Market Trends for 2025 Near Tech Hubs

The Austin real estate market in 2025 is offering more room for buyers to negotiate in tech-adjacent neighborhoods. According to Unlock MLS, homes spent an average of 66 days on the market in March 2025 — giving buyers more leverage than in recent years.

With interest rates leveling out and buyer confidence returning, the market is gradually warming up. However, neighborhoods near major tech employers continue to see steady appreciation.


Tips for Buying Near Austin Tech Hubs

Partner with a Local Real Estate Expert
A knowledgeable local agent can help you explore off-market opportunities and evaluate micro-markets across different tech corridors.

Explore Commute Flexibility
Remote or hybrid professionals can explore areas farther out — like
Manor, Buda, or Taylor — to find more space and competitive pricing.

Look Into New Construction Options
East and North Austin are booming with new builds. Ask your agent about incentives like
builder-paid closing costs or interest rate buy-downs.

Think Long-Term
Historically, homes near tech employment centers have shown strong long-term appreciation. While past performance doesn’t guarantee future results, proximity to major employers remains a key consideration for many buyers.

FAQs: Buying Near Tech Hubs in Austin

What are the best neighborhoods near The Domain in Austin?
Wells Branch, North Burnet, and Milwood offer great access to major tech employers with varied price points.

Is it a good time to buy near Tesla's Austin Gigafactory?
Yes. Areas like Del Valle and Easton Park are seeing active development and present opportunities for early investment.

How far is Downtown Austin from major tech hubs?
Downtown is centrally located — about 10–20 minutes from The Domain, 20 minutes to Apple, and under 15 minutes to Tesla.

Are homes near Austin tech campuses more expensive?
Generally, yes — but areas like East Austin, Wells Branch, and Jollyville still provide relatively accessible options.
